What is a key element to ensure passenger safety during travel?

Explanation:
Ensuring passenger safety during travel involves making sure all passengers are seated and secured before the bus starts moving. This practice minimizes the risk of injuries that can occur from sudden stops, sharp turns, or potential accidents. When passengers are seated and properly secured, they are less likely to be thrown from their seats or collide with other passengers or fixtures inside the bus. The focus on passenger seating and securing also helps establish a calm environment on the bus, allowing the driver to concentrate on the road and any potential hazards without the added distraction of managing passengers who might not be properly positioned. In addition, having passengers seated promotes overall stability and reduces the likelihood of movement that can affect the bus's center of gravity during travel. This core safety measure is essential for a safe and comfortable transit experience, highlighting the importance of proactive measures to ensure the well-being of all passengers on board.
